Whether you're based in Delhi, Noida, or any other city, the process of company registration in India follows similar steps. In India, companies can be registered as private limited companies, public limited companies, or limited liability partnerships (LLPs), depending on the nature of the business and the goals of the founders. To get started, you'll need to submit a few essential documents, such as the company's name, address, and details of directors, and register with the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A). By registering your company, you not only comply with legal requirements but also gain access to numerous benefits such as tax advantages, credibility, and a larger customer base.

- Building a Strong Business Foundation
Once you have your company registration sorted, the next step is to focus on building a strong business foundation. Here are some key tips for startup success:
- Create a Business Plan: A clear, well-structured business plan will guide your startup's journey. Outline your goals, strategies, target audience, and financial projections.
- Focus on Marketing: Whether you're in Delhi, Noida, or Gurgaon, make sure your marketing strategy speaks to your audience. Use digital marketing, social media, and SEO to boost your presence.
- Build a Team: Surround yourself with talented individuals who share your vision. Your team will play a major role in your startup's growth.
- Stay Compliant: Always stay updated on business laws, taxes, and regulatory requirements. Regularly check if your registration needs renewal or if any compliance paperwork is due.
- Adapt and Innovate: The market is always changing, so keep an eye out for trends and adapt your business accordingly.
